What the SAMHSA Record Shows About Absolute Advocacy LLC

Absolute Advocacy LLC is a substance use treatment operated by Private for-profit organization in Charlotte, North Carolina. The facility's N-SUMHSS record lists 2 primary care modalities (outpatient, telehealth), which shapes both how treatment is delivered and how intake is scheduled. MAT is not listed in the current record; callers seeking medication-assisted options should verify directly or check the rankings pages for nearby providers that do offer MAT. The full postal address on file is 1923 J N Pease Place, Suite 102, Charlotte, NC 28262.

On the services side, the facility self-reports 7 distinct service lines (Cognitive behavioral therapy, Intensive outpatient, Mental health services, Motivational interviewing, Outpatient, Substance use treatment, Telehealth), 3 substance or condition categories treated (Alcohol, General substance use disorders, Opioids), and 5 clinical treatment approaches (Cognitive behavioral therapy, Motivational interviewing, Relapse prevention, Substance use disorder counseling, Telemedicine/telehealth therapy). It serves 8 specific population groups (Active duty military, Justice-involved individuals, Men, Persons with DUI/DWI, Persons with HIV/AIDS, Persons with co-occurring disorders, Veterans, Women) with 1 language of care (Spanish). Those figures give a rough signal of programmatic breadth, a higher number of approaches and populations usually indicates more structured clinical programming rather than a single-modality operation. Payment-wise, the record confirms no payment channels confirmed in the SAMHSA record, plus 1 specific payment method enumerated in the survey (Cash or self-payment).

Absolute Advocacy LLC reports 26 attributes across services, populations, payment, and language, in line with the North Carolina statewide median of 31 (521 facilities listed).
